ABSTRACT:
A safety support for mounting on a split rim inside a tire chamber to resiliently support the tread portion of the tire in the deflated condition and maintain the bead portions of the tire in separated positions. The support is in the form of an annular ring of resilient material having a base with a relatively wide radially inner surface for seating on the rim and separating the bead portions. A flange extends radially inward from the radially inner surface of the base for gripping by the rim sections to seal the space within the tire and retain the ring on the rim. The radially outer portion of the support has a diameter less than the diameter of the tread portion of the tire in the deflated condition and greater than the diameter of the base portion. The base portion may be of greater width than the radially outer portion and be connected to the outer portion by an intermediate supporting portion of circumferentially spaced-apart radially extending ribs for cushioning the vehicle on which the tire, safety support and rim assembly are mounted.
